J&K Govt launches ambitious rural empowerment initiatives

12,000 new SHGs in fiscal year 2024-25 to empower rural areas

Srinagar, Mar 31: In a significant move towards rural development, the Rural Development and Panchayati Raj of the Jammu and Kashmir Government has announced plans to establish 12,000 additional Self Help Groups (SHGs) during the fiscal year 2024-25. 
According to official communication, these SHGs will play a pivotal role in fostering self-reliance and entrepreneurship among rural individuals, thereby stimulating economic growth and social development at the grassroots level. 
The government's commitment to rural progress extends beyond SHGs, with various initiatives underway to bolster employment opportunities and enhance infrastructure in rural areas. 
Under the Mahatma Gandhi National Rural Employment Guarantee Act (MGNREGA), the aim is to generate 400 lakh mandays of work, while the HIMAYAT scheme is set to complete training for approximately 7000 candidates.
Furthermore, in a bid to fortify local governance, the government plans to construct 600 new panchayatghars under the Rashtriya Gram SwarajAbhiyan (RGSA), all equipped with 100% internet connectivity. Additionally, 2.60 lakh mandays of training will be provided to Panchayati Raj Institution (PRI) members under RGSA.
Housing infrastructure is also slated for improvement, with 80,000 houses earmarked for construction under the PradhanMantriAwasYojanaGramin (PMAY-G).
In alignment with environmental sustainability goals, the government aims to provide solid/liquid waste management facilities in villages to promote cleanliness and reduce plastic waste. The Integrated Watershed Management Programme (IWMP) will further contribute to environmental conservation by treating a 26,000-hectare area through the completion of 1800 works during the upcoming fiscal year.
These comprehensive initiatives underscore the government's commitment to holistic rural development and empowerment, aiming to uplift communities and foster sustainable progress across Jammu and Kashmir.
